Back to Browse

Entity Framework Core : Validation & Data Annotations en C# — Required, MaxLength, FluentValidation

192 views
Jul 31, 2025
14:04

Dans cette vidéo, tu apprends à valider les données avec Entity Framework Core en C# en utilisant les Data Annotations et la validation côté modèle (et côté service/API) dans Visual Studio. On couvre les attributs essentiels ([Required], [StringLength], [MaxLength], [Range], [EmailAddress], [RegularExpression], [Precision], [Index]), la différence entre validation et contraintes de schéma, comment déclencher la validation (MVC ModelState, TryValidateModel, IValidatableObject), et quand préférer la Fluent API ou FluentValidation. Que vous soyez débutant ou développeur confirmé, cette vidéo vous aidera à mieux comprendre la puissance des annotations dans EF Core. Ref: - Développement d'applications modernes avec C# https://amzn.to/4oMyCVR - C# 14 and .NET 10 – Modern Cross-Platform Development Fundamentals https://amzn.to/4qpaDw7 🔧 Contenu abordé : 00:00 Introduction aux Data Annotations 00:55 Validation côté modèle avec les attributs 04:45 Migration de la base de données avec EF 07:45 configurer le nom de la table et le nom de la clé primaire 13:30 Récapitulatif 👉 Abonne‑toi pour plus de tutos C#, EF Core, ASP.NET Core et Visual Studio. 💬 Dis en commentaire si tu veux un épisode dédié à FluentValidation ou aux Value Converters pour les validations avancées

Download

0 formats

No download links available.

Entity Framework Core : Validation & Data Annotations en C# — Required, MaxLength, FluentValidation | NatokHD